The transmission of internal force between concrete and reinforcement and their displacement gap are called as bond stress and slip, respectively. The bond constitutive laws are defined as the relationship between bond stress and slip. There are lots of proposed types of bond constitutive laws, so it is necessary that the laws should be selected carefully to adopt in finite element analysis. Japan Concrete Institute organized the Technical Committee for bond problems to clarify the information about bond constitutive laws and propose the appropriate applications of the laws. Some of committee activities such as meso-scale analysis, review works for previous papers and analysis results for tension-stiffening effect are introduced.
A long time has passed since the control measure of alkali-aggregate reaction (alkali-silica reaction : ASR) was prescribed by JIS. So it's contemplated that the control measure of ASR prescribed by JIS on aggregate of concrete has worked on the reduction of ASR. However, there are the damages by ASR in the concrete structures using the aggregate judged “Harmless” by JIS. Therefore, in JR East Japan, the new judgement method of aggregate was set. The number of classification of judgement on aggregate was changed from two into three without changing the current aggregate test method by JIS. Moreover, use of effective blended cement was set as the method for control of ASR.
